Dustin1280 posted...
I love that, but I have a subscription to Netflix, Hulu, and Prime anyway.

I have been going back and fourth on a crunchyroll subscription, but so far have resisted.

Crunchyroll and Funimation have the widest selection of anime, much bigger than those sites, especially so since they made their partnership official and they've been sharing titles. CR has been adding subs of Funi shows, while Funi has been adding dubs and even making new dubs of CR shows. If you like anime and primarily watch anime subbed, a CR subscription is a fantastic deal for how much anime is on the site. Likewise for Funi if you primarily watch dubbed.

If you already had subscriptions to those other sites for non-anime reasons and don't see enough unique anime on CR/Funi to justify the purchase, then that's understandable. But at least look through the CR/Funi library and see how many anime they have that you would want to watch.

Maze_ posted...
I don't get how anime creators even make money anymore.

Most anime these days are just ads to sell more of the manga or light novels they're based off of, so they make money off those sales. A truly original anime doing well and making money is a rare sight these days. I mean, they do happen, but they're rare.

Calwyn posted...
MwarriorHiei posted...
dont get a crunchyroll sub, get the vrv package instead so you get crunchy and funimation.

I've been meaning to look into that.

Is VRV cheaper than having separate CR/Funi subscriptions?
Can I still watch CR/Funi on all of the same devices as I can now?

the VRV bundle is $10 so its a few bucks cheaper than having two subs. you also get a few other channels and you can probably still use the same devices.

https://help.vrv.co/hc/en-us/articles/215116623-VRV-Premium-and-Bundle-FAQ-Details
Bundle:

Crunchyroll
Funimation
Rooster Teeth
Cartoon Hangover
Geek & Sundry
Nerdist
MONDO
Tested
...
What devices is VRV available on?

VRV is available on the Web, Xbox One, PlayStation 4, Chromecast, iOS phones/iPads, Android phones and newer Roku devices. More devices will be announced as they become available.


Villain posted...
So I never heard of VRV until now. What does a free account give?

free account should be the same as free crunchy/funi so it doesnt really matter unless you also want to watch the other stuff thats on VRV.
